When the amplitude of a wave becomes double its energy become_________________?

Correct answer: B. Four times

  • A. Double
  • B. Four times
  • C. One half
  • D. None time

Explanation

The energy carried by a wave is proportional to the square of its amplitude, E ∝ A². If amplitude changes from A to 2A, the energy becomes (2A)²/A² = 4 times the original energy. The common mistake is choosing a because the amplitude itself doubled, while wave energy depends on amplitude squared.

About Progressive Waves

Progressive waves transfer energy through a medium or space while particles oscillate about their equilibrium positions. The work includes amplitude, wavelength, frequency, period, phase difference, wave speed and the progressive wave equation, while distinguishing travelling waves from stationary waves, where the pattern has fixed nodes and antinodes.
